Transaction 8171b9133e648441f6e622075616b33286d1615b05882775e8ec30915b0b5f81

1 Input
2 Outputs
  • 8171b9133e648441f6e622075616b33286d1615b05882775e8ec30915b0b5f81:0
  • value  2515284509
    address  1LLDi7DcJesUdGb8aQP3zqriHZKVHazH3V
  • 8171b9133e648441f6e622075616b33286d1615b05882775e8ec30915b0b5f81:1
  • value  51170127
    address  1PwKW4A5MPkTMZsQK1N69XTTmKxh22giR4